Description:

Hybrid at Reston, VA 2nd Round In-Person

Develops and implements security solutions. Administers security technology systems by architecting and engineering/developing trusted systems into secure systems. Assists in the development of implementation and deployment plans that are aligned to the organizational strategic plan objectives and security requirements. Advises management in developing cybersecurity policies, processes, and procedures.

Essential Functions

20% Assists with day-to-day support of security solutions. 20% Assists with engineering support and system administration of specialized cybersecurity solutions. 15% Solves complex problems and answers routine questions about the installation, operation, configuration, and customization of cybersecurity software. 15% Identifies potential conflicts with the implementation of any cybersecurity solutions. 10% Answers routine questions about the installation, operation, configuration, and customization of cybersecurity solutions. 10% Reviews and analyzes appropriate cybersecurity solution system logs for performance and functional anomalies. 10% Works with system design architects and project managers to provide security requirements.

Preferred Qualifications Mid-Level Cybersecurity Engineer

• Hands-on experience with application security, software development, secure SDLC, DevSecOps practices, CI/CD automation. • Experience with one or more programming or scripting languages such as Java, JavaScript, Python with focus on secure coding practices and vulnerability management. • Deep understanding of operating systems (Linux/Windows), networking protocols, and scripting/programming languages like python. • Experience with container security, Kubernetes, Helm, Docker, and cloud native workload protection. • Familiarity with application security testing tools such as Checkmarx, Contrast Security, TideLift, Burp Suite, OWASP Dependency Check, Fortinet or similar platforms. • Experience with vulnerability identification, triage, remediation validation, and risk-based prioritization. • Experience working with CI/CD and source code management platforms such as Bitbucket, GitLab, GitHub, Jenkins, or similar tools. • Experience supporting security automation, metrics reporting, and vulnerability management integrations with tools such as Jira, ServiceNow, or risk management platforms • Hands-on experience securing cloud environments, preferably AWS. • Professional certifications such as the Offensive Security Certified professional (OSCP) or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) preferred.
